Asthma Care

To better meet the needs of our patients with asthma, and to better manage each individual's asthma, Wayzata Children's Clinic has developed an Asthma Service Line. Our service line is based on the most current research about asthma and the most current national asthma guidelines to promote the optimal health of our patients. Our Asthma management will help to maximize each patient's potential lung functioning and minimize exacerbations and the need for rescue medications. 

Our patients with asthma will receive:

  • comprehensive asthma assessment at least two times per year to ensure each patient is on the proper medications to promote optimal lung function
  • written individualized Asthma Action Plan for families to have at home and at school, including emergency medical plan
  • yearly lung function testing (starting at age 5 if patient is able)
  • allergy testing (if appropriate)
  • individualized education and training about asthma and proper use of medications and medication devices
  • yearly influenza vaccine
  • management of asthma exacerbations
  • appropriate follow up of exacerbations and ER or urgent care visits
